Highlights
- VSync, short for Vertical Synchronization, is a graphical technology designed to eliminate screen tearing, a common visual artifact that occurs when the refresh rate of a display and the frame rate of a game are not in sync.
- VSync is typically recommended for use in games where screen tearing is a significant issue and input lag is not a major concern.
- It is only recommended for games where screen tearing is a significant issue and input lag is not a major concern.
VSync, short for Vertical Synchronization, is a graphical technology designed to eliminate screen tearing, a common visual artifact that occurs when the refresh rate of a display and the frame rate of a game are not in sync. Screen tearing manifests as a horizontal line that divides the screen, with the upper portion displaying a newer frame and the lower portion showing an older frame.
How VSync Works
VSync operates by aligning the game’s frame rate with the display’s refresh rate. When VSync is enabled, the game will only render a new frame when the display is ready to refresh, preventing the display of partial frames. This ensures that the entire frame is displayed at once, eliminating screen tearing.
Advantages of VSync
- Eliminates Screen Tearing: VSync’s primary advantage is its ability to eliminate screen tearing, providing a smoother and more immersive gaming experience.
- Reduces Input Lag: While VSync can introduce input lag, it can also reduce input lag in some cases. This is because VSync prevents the display of frames that are not yet complete, ensuring that the most up-to-date frame is always displayed.
- Improved Visual Quality: VSync can improve visual quality by reducing flickering and stuttering, which can occur when the frame rate is not synchronized with the refresh rate.
Disadvantages of VSync
- Increased Input Lag: VSync can introduce input lag, especially in fast-paced games. This is because the game must wait for the display to refresh before rendering a new frame, which can delay the display of user inputs.
- Reduced Frame Rate: VSync can cap the frame rate at the display’s refresh rate, which can reduce visual smoothness in games that run at higher frame rates.
- Compatibility Issues: VSync may not be compatible with all games and graphics cards, especially older ones.
When to Use VSync
VSync is typically recommended for use in games where screen tearing is a significant issue and input lag is not a major concern. It is particularly beneficial in games with slow-paced gameplay or cinematic cutscenes.
When Not to Use VSync
VSync should be disabled in games where input lag is critical, such as competitive first-person shooters or rhythm games. It is also not recommended in games that already run at high frame rates, as VSync can cap the frame rate and reduce visual smoothness.
Alternative Solutions to Screen Tearing
If VSync is not suitable for a particular game, there are alternative solutions to screen tearing, such as:
- Adaptive Sync Technologies: Adaptive sync technologies, such as NVIDIA G-Sync and AMD FreeSync, dynamically adjust the refresh rate of the display to match the frame rate of the game, eliminating screen tearing without introducing input lag.
- Fast Sync: Fast Sync is a hybrid technology that combines VSync with a frame rate limiter to reduce input lag while still eliminating screen tearing.
- Triple Buffering: Triple buffering is a technique that creates a buffer of three frames, allowing the game to render frames in advance and reducing the likelihood of screen tearing.
Information You Need to Know
1. What is the recommended VSync setting?
The optimal VSync setting depends on the specific game and hardware configuration. Generally, VSync should be enabled for games with significant screen tearing and disabled for games where input lag is a major concern.
2. Can VSync be used with any display?
VSync is compatible with most modern displays, but it may not work with older displays that do not support VSync.
3. Does VSync affect performance?
VSync can reduce performance by capping the frame rate at the display’s refresh rate. The impact on performance will vary depending on the game and hardware configuration.
4. Can VSync cause stuttering?
VSync can cause stuttering in games that run at frame rates below the display’s refresh rate. This is because VSync will force the game to wait for the display to refresh before rendering a new frame, which can delay the display of frames.
5. Is VSync necessary for all games?
VSync is not necessary for all games. It is only recommended for games where screen tearing is a significant issue and input lag is not a major concern.